MySQL连接数据库conn全攻略:轻松实现数据交互与操作

资源类型:70-0.net 2025-07-27 22:42

mysql连接数据库conn简介:



深入解析MySQL数据库连接:以“conn”为起点 在当今的数据驱动时代,数据库技术无疑是信息技术的核心

    其中,MySQL以其稳定性、易用性和强大的功能成为了众多企业和开发者的首选数据库系统

    在使用MySQL时,建立与数据库的连接是第一步,也是最关键的一步

    这个连接通常通过“conn”这个对象或变量来实现

    本文将从“conn”出发,深入解析MySQL数据库的连接过程、常见问题及其解决方案

     一、MySQL连接的重要性 在数据库应用中,无论是进行数据查询、插入、更新还是删除,都需要先与数据库建立连接

    这个连接就像是一座桥梁,连接着应用程序和数据库服务器

    没有这座桥梁,任何与数据库的交互都无从谈起

    因此,“conn”这个连接对象,虽然看似简单,却承载着至关重要的任务

     二、建立MySQL连接的基本步骤 1.安装MySQL Connector:首先,你需要在你的开发环境中安装MySQL的连接器(如MySQL Connector/Python)

    这个连接器提供了与MySQL数据库交互的API

     2.导入必要的库:在代码中,你需要导入用于连接MySQL的库

    在Python中,这通常是通过`import mysql.connector`来实现的

     3.创建连接:使用连接器提供的API函数(如`mysql.connector.connect()`)来建立与MySQL数据库的连接

    这个函数通常需要传递一些参数,如主机名、用户名、密码和数据库名等

     4.执行SQL语句:一旦连接建立,你就可以通过“conn”对象执行SQL语句了

    这通常涉及到创建一个游标对象,通过游标来执行SQL命令并获取结果

     5.关闭连接:完成数据库操作后,务必关闭游标和连接,以释放资源并避免潜在的安全风险

     三、连接过程中的常见问题及解决方案 1.连接失败:这可能是由于网络问题、错误的认证信息或数据库服务器不可用等原因造成的

    解决方案包括检查网络连接、确认认证信息的准确性以及确保数据库服务器正在运行

     2.超时错误:如果连接过程中发生超时,可能是由于网络延迟、数据库服务器负载过高或配置问题导致的

    你可以尝试增加超时时间设置,或者优化数据库服务器的性能

     3.权限问题:如果连接时遇到权限错误,应检查所提供的用户名和密码是否正确,并确保该用户具有访问指定数据库的权限

     四、优化与最佳实践 1.使用连接池:对于需要频繁连接数据库的应用,使用连接池可以显著提高性能

    连接池可以复用已经建立的连接,避免频繁地创建和关闭连接

     2.异常处理:在代码中添加适当的异常处理逻辑,以便在连接失败或其他错误发生时能够优雅地处理

     3.安全性考虑:不要在代码中硬编码数据库认证信息,而是使用配置文件或环境变量来管理这些信息

    此外,使用SSL/TLS加密连接以增加数据传输的安全性

     4.资源管理:确保在每次使用完数据库连接后都正确关闭它,以避免资源泄漏和潜在的安全风险

     五、结论 “conn”作为连接MySQL数据库的关键对象,在数据库应用中发挥着举足轻重的作用

    通过深入了解连接过程、常见问题及其解决方案,以及遵循一些优化和最佳实践,我们可以更有效地利用MySQL数据库,为应用程序提供稳定、高效的数据存储和检索服务

    无论是在Web开发、数据分析还是其他需要数据库支持的领域,掌握MySQL连接的细节都是至关重要的

    

阅读全文
上一篇:MySQL设置默认参数指南

最新收录:

  • 一键升级:yum轻松更新MySQL数据库
  • MySQL设置默认参数指南
  • 利用MySQL轻松制作专业级数据报表
  • H5与MySQL数据库的连接方法与实战解析
  • MySQL安装指南:轻松上手自带Workbench教程
  • MySQL递归查询:向上追溯数据秘籍
  • MySQL Schema设计指南解析
  • MySQL基础第五章实训代码详解
  • 掌握高效技巧:如何精准引用MySQL数据库资源
  • MySQL能否存储图片格式详解
  • MySQL数据库智能生成日期,轻松管理时间数据
  • 小内存MySQL优化技巧大揭秘
  • 首页 | mysql连接数据库conn:MySQL连接数据库conn全攻略:轻松实现数据交互与操作